Handoff stopped working with El Capitan

Hi,
On my iMac, Handoff worked without problems with Yosemite, but since the arrival of El Capitan, no luck.
Between iPhone (9.1) iPad (9.1) and Watch (2.0.1) no problem. Handoff and instant hotspot work flawlessly.

But on the mac side (now with 10.11.1), no luck.

The System informations show that I am handoff compatible
Screen Shot 2015-10-22 at 11.15.31.png

Handoff is enabled in System preferences
Screen Shot 2015-10-22 at 11.15.46.png

iCloud is enabled on all devices, which are inches apart from one another and all on the same wifi
Screen Shot 2015-10-22 at 11.16.07.png

The fact that handoff/instant hotspot work from iDevice to iDevice tend to hint at a Os X problem, so I did a complete reinstall yesterday after the arrival of 10.11.1, but no luck.

Any idea?

Note that I already did all the usual raindance (Sign out/in of iCloud, bluetooth off/on, wifi Off/on, PRAM)...

Note also that 5 months ago, I swapped the wifi/bluetooth module of my iMac (2011 model) for an apple / broadcom BCM94360CD to have Wifi AC & Bluetooth 4.0 and this worked flawlessly under Yosemite, without any modification to the software needed
